国内英语新闻:Xi extends condolences over death of Chinese rocket expert
BEIJING, April 17 (Xinhua) -- Chinese President Xi Jinping has offered condolences to the family of rocket scientist Liang Sili, who died of illness at the age of 91 in Beijing Thursday.
In his message, Xi deeply mourned the loss of Liang, who after the founding of New China, returned to the country and devoted himself tirelessly to China's aerospace program.
"He made important contributions to China's aerospace cause. His patriotism, dedication and rigorous scholarship deserve our respect," Xi said.
Liang was one of the founders of China's aerospace cause, and a renowned missile and rocket control expert. He was a member of both the Chinese Academy of Sciences and the International Academy of Astronautics.
